What platforms will GTA 6 be available on at launch?
Currently, Rockstar Games has confirmed the GTA 6 game release for P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X/S consoles. This means if you own a current-generation console, you'll be among the first to experience the expansive world of Leonida and Vice City. Historically, Rockstar's Grand Theft Auto titles have often launched on consoles first, with a PC version following several months, or even a year, later. This pattern held true for GTA V and Red Dead Redemption 2, so PC gamers should temper expectations for a day-and-date release.
For those considering a platform switch or upgrade, knowing this console-first approach is crucial. If you're a dedicated PC gamer but don't want to wait, investing in a PS5 or Xbox Series X/S might be an option. The console versions are optimized to leverage the latest hardware, promising stunning visuals, faster load times, and immersive gameplay. Keep an eye out for any official announcements regarding a PC version, as the landscape of gaming is constantly evolving, with more titles embracing simultaneous multi-platform releases, though Rockstar has been an exception to this trend.
How can I prepare my gaming setup for GTA 6?
Getting your gaming rig ready for the GTA 6 game release is crucial for a smooth experience, whether you're on console or PC. For console gamers, ensure you have ample storage space. Modern games like GTA 6 are massive, easily exceeding 100GB. Consider purchasing an external SSD or freeing up existing space on your PS5 or Xbox Series X/S. Also, ensure your console's firmware is up-to-date for optimal performance and security.
PC gamers face a bit more homework. While official system requirements for GTA 6 haven't been released, we can make educated guesses based on current-gen games. Expect a strong CPU (like an Intel Core i7 or AMD Ryzen 7), at least 16GB of RAM, and a modern GPU (NVIDIA RTX 30 series/40 series or AMD RX 6000 series/7000 series) to be the recommended specs for a great experience. Many US gamers are on a budget for hardware upgrades. Start by checking your current specs using tools like DirectX Diagnostic Tool (dxdiag) on Windows. If upgrades are needed, prioritize your GPU and then your CPU. Ensure your drivers are updated regularly, as game-ready drivers often release close to major game launches. A stable, fast internet connection is also vital for downloads and online play, especially with trends showing increased reliance on social gaming and online components.

Are there budget-friendly ways to upgrade for GTA 6?
Absolutely! Preparing your setup for the GTA 6 game release doesn't have to empty your wallet. For PC gamers, start by identifying your weakest link. Often, it's the GPU. Instead of buying brand new, consider the thriving market for used graphics cards. Reputable sellers or refurbished units can offer significant savings. Websites like eBay or local hardware forums often have great deals, but always verify seller reputation and test components upon arrival. Another cost-effective upgrade is an SSD. If you're still running games off a hard drive, switching to an SSD (even a SATA one) will drastically improve load times and overall system responsiveness, enhancing your GTA 6 experience without needing a top-tier NVMe drive.
Memory (RAM) is another easy and often affordable upgrade. If you're running 8GB, moving to 16GB will make a noticeable difference in modern games. For console players, storage expansion through officially licensed external SSDs is the primary budget-friendly route. Look for sales events around major holidays or specific gaming promotions. Don't forget software optimizations: ensuring your operating system is clean, background apps are minimized, and drivers are up-to-date can often yield surprising performance gains without spending a dime. Remember, value for money is key, and smart upgrades can make a big impact.

Will GTA 6 offer cross-play or cross-progression?
The possibility of cross-play and cross-progression for the GTA 6 game release is a hot topic, especially with the rise of multi-platform gaming and mobile gaming's influence on console/PC expectations. While Rockstar has not officially confirmed these features for GTA 6, the gaming industry is moving towards greater interconnectivity. Cross-play, allowing players on different platforms (e.g., PS5 and Xbox Series X/S) to play together, would significantly boost the online community and enhance social gaming trends. It addresses a common pain point for friends on different systems wanting to team up.
Cross-progression, which lets you carry your game progress and purchases between platforms, would be a huge win for gamers who own multiple systems or plan to upgrade. Imagine starting on PS5 and continuing your journey on a future PC version without losing anything. While Rockstar has historically been cautious with these features, the growing demand from players, especially adult gamers who value flexibility, might push them in this direction. Keep an eye on official announcements; if implemented, these features would make GTA 6 an even more accessible and engaging experience for its diverse player base.

What city is GTA 6 set in?
GTA 6 is set in the fictional state of Leonida, which prominently features a modern-day rendition of Vice City, a beloved location from previous Grand Theft Auto titles. This vibrant setting draws inspiration from Miami, promising a dynamic and visually stunning environment for players to explore.
